The exponential moving average (EMA) is a weighted average of recent period's prices. It uses an exponentially decreasing weight from each previous priceperiod. In other words, the formula gives recent prices more weight than past prices. For example, a four-period EMA has prices of 1.5554, 1.5555, 1.5558, and 1.5560. .

Python code to calculate the Trimmed mean Weighted mean The weighted mean is a type of mean that is calculated by multiplying the weight (or probability) associated with a particular event or outcome with its associated quantitative outcome and. jingle ideas. explore alaska sweepstakes 2022 aspen court floor. Linear Weighted Moving Average (LWMA) Formula The Linear Weighted Moving Average formula is Unlike Simple Moving Average , where the weight of all previous bars is equal, the. The volume-weighted moving average is a simple way of improvement for traders who are accustomed to using simple moving averages for market analysis. It provides signals of an upcoming trend, the continuation of a trend, trend reversal, and the identification of the divergences. However, technical analysts always advise not to use a single indicator for.

param data Input data, must be 1D or 2D array. param alpha scalar float in range (0,1) The alpha parameter for the moving average. param axis The axis to apply the moving. The three moving average crossover strategy is an approach to trading that uses 3 exponential moving averages of various lengths. All moving averages are lagging indicators however when used correctly, can help frame the market for a trader. You can see how MAs can give you information about market states by looking at the Alligator trading.

SMA 23.82. 2. Exponential Moving Average (EMA) The other type of moving average is the exponential moving average (EMA), which gives more weight to the most recent price points to make it more responsive to recent data points. An exponential moving average tends to be more responsive to recent price changes, as compared to the simple moving. Linear Weighted Moving Average is one more that is usually calculated using loops and that makes it slower as the calculating period gets longer. This version is solving that and that makes it suitable for usage via iCustom() calls. Explosion5. Advisor scalper. Trading algorithm Candle0> Candle1 2. Taimeframe - 4H && Day. Simple moving average. Simple.

Below we provide an example of how we can apply a weighted moving average with a rolling window. Assume that we have the following data frame and we want to get a moving.

Weighted Averages A weighted average is simply an average of n numbers where each number is given a certain weight and the denominator is the sum of those n weights. The weights are often assigned as per some weighing function. Common weighing functions are logarithmic, linear, quadratic, cubic and exponential. Averaging as a time series.

The linearly weighted moving average (LWMA) is a moving average that puts more weight on recent price data in a linear fashion the most recent price has the highest weighting, with each prior price getting progressively less weight. As a result, for any given period, the LWMA reacts more quickly to price changes than a simple moving average (SMA) and an exponential.

A snippet to calculate average typing speed. The snippet that I demonstrated in the . the words-per-minute calculation is updated in real-time as the values for tabstops one and two are changed. We could make that function available to other snippet files by moving it into a .vimpythonx.

Whereas in the Weighted Moving Average and Exponential Moving Average, the weight assigned to each value varies is greater for the most recent values that are taken into account, while is lower for the oldest values. These two moving averages, as the Simple Moving Average, are calculated over a period that you choose (It may be a period. A Python trading framework for cryptocurrency markets. Jesse. Home open in new window. Blog open in new window. Help Center open in new window. Fibonacci's Weighted Moving Average) 10 hma (Hull Moving Average) 11 linearreg (Linear Regression) 12 wilders (Wilders Smoothing).

param data Input data, must be 1D or 2D array. param alpha scalar float in range (0,1) The alpha parameter for the moving average. param axis The axis to apply the moving average on. If axisNone, the data is flattened. param offset optional The offset for the moving average. Must be scalar or a vector with one element for each row of. Weighted average ensembles assume that some models in the ensemble have more skill than others and give them more contribution when making predictions. The.

One of the oldest and simplest trading strategies that exist is the one that uses a moving average of the price (or returns) timeseries to proxy the recent trend of the price. The idea is quite simple, yet powerful; if we use a (say) 100-day moving average of our price time-series, then a significant portion of the daily price noise will have been "averaged-out". Thus, we can can observe more.

Whereas in the Weighted Moving Average and Exponential Moving Average, the weight assigned to each value varies is greater for the most recent values that are taken into account, while is lower for the oldest values. These two moving averages, as the Simple Moving Average, are calculated over a period that you choose (It may be a period.